Q2 Planning Note — Launch: Ferrowick S2

Sales leads: Ferrowick S2 ships week 9. Demo kits arrive week 7; training is mandatory. Pricing tiers locked — no side deals. Target: 400 units in the Dornhaven corridor by quarter close. Marketing runs teaser spots from week 5. Hold S1 inventory at current discount; do not deep-cut. Channel partners in Westmere get first allocation. Pipeline reviews move to weekly. Escalate supply issues to ops immediately. Read the following and keep it within this group.

internal memo for yafog-fajog: Gross margin on Ralael came in at 15 percent against a plan of 10 percent. Only 7 of the 120 pilot accounts renewed Ralael, so a churn review is set for July 15.

The Verdanta scheduler exposes a single endpoint for creating watering plans; each plan binds a plant profile to a moisture threshold and a recurrence rule. Requests are idempotent when a client-supplied plan token is included, so retries after timeouts are safe. Maintainers should note that the soil-sensor aggregation runs on a separate internal service, and the scheduler authenticates to it on every plan evaluation. That internal hop is the most common failure point during rotations. The current key for that service follows.

gateway credential: kto23_LX9A4ys6i4nzHtpOLNLodKK

Subject: Cooler run – Harlow Field Clinic

Dispatch,

Two vaccine coolers leave the Vexmark depot at 06:30 tomorrow, bound for Harlow Field Clinic via the Ordell bypass. Cold chain max window is four hours — no layovers. Receiving staff at Harlow must log internal temps on arrival and sign both units. Reject anything above range and notify the duty nurse immediately. The courier has been briefed separately; follow the hand-over instruction below exactly.

handover note for yagef-bagep: the drudor pelius courier leaves the kasdor zorvan norir ledger at gate 8016 under passcode 755406

# Settings for Chunkview, our large-file diff viewer.
# Quick note for the release manager: the streaming diff engine
# chokes if max_chunk_mb is set above 64 on the Bramwell boxes,
# so please don't "optimize" that before a release again. Diff
# metadata (file hashes, chunk offsets, render cache keys) is
# stored in a small Postgres instance rather than on disk.
# The viewer reads that metadata using the connection string
# configured below.

primary connection of yagep-kahip = redis://giliel_svc:zYiKsLL2PLpfPL@db-348f.xolmarsys.corp:5432/fenwyn